The arrangement in 1944 recognized centralized monetary management rules between Australia, Japan, the United States, Canada, and a number of Western European nations. Generally, the world's economy remained in shambles after The second world war, so 730 delegates from 44 Allied countries gathered in New Hampshire in a hotel called Bretton Woods. Triffin’s Dilemma.

Treasury department official Harry Dexter White. Many historians think the closed-door Bretton Woods meeting centralized the entire world's monetary system (Reserve Currencies). On the meeting's final day, Bretton Woods delegates codified a code of guidelines for the world's monetary system and conjured up the World Bank Group and the IMF. Essentially, since the U.S. controlled more than two-thirds of the world's gold, the system would count on gold and the U.S. dollar. However, Richard Nixon surprised the world when he got rid of the gold part out of the Bretton Woods pact in August 1971. As quickly as the Bretton Woods system was up and running, a variety of individuals slammed the plan and said the Bretton Woods meeting and subsequent developments bolstered world inflation.

The editorialist was Henry Hazlitt and his posts like "End the IMF" were extremely controversial to the status quo. In the editorial, Hazlitt stated that he composed thoroughly about how the introduction of the IMF had triggered enormous nationwide currency devaluations. Hazlitt explained the British pound lost a third of its worth overnight in 1949. "In the years from the end of 1952 to the end of 1962, 43 leading currencies diminished," the economic expert detailed back in 1963. "The U.S. dollar revealed a loss in internal acquiring power of 12 percent, the British pound of 25 percent, the French franc of 30 percent.
